Good Points: Laser printer, works on Unix/Linux/Windows, works with not original drivers, great text quality
Bad Points: Image printing quality
General comments: I needed solution for one printer for multiple operating systems and low price.
I checked market and found that Lexmark gives laser printer with 16M RAM and 200MHS processor and supports other operating systems than Windows in much lower prices than competitors.
The main usage of this printer is for text, so quality and about 20ppm are great.
This device already printed about 1500 pages on a single toner that I still did not change and it still does.
Printer has USB and LPT connections, drivers for MAC, Linux and Windows.
It supports PCL (emulation) so it can be used with a wide range of drivers.
I print from this printer with Fedora Core 5 Linux, and Solaris 10 (with CUPS).
High performance, low price, good quality and support of various of operating systems make this printer to lead this category.
I recommend this printer for small offices and for personal use where most of demand is black and write text.
